मल्टी-प्रोसेस फ़ायरफ़ॉक्स: वह सब कुछ जो आपको जानना आवश्यक है

समस्याओं को खत्म करने के लिए हमारे साधन का प्रयास करें

विकास और कई देरी के बाद, बहु-प्रक्रिया फ़ायरफ़ॉक्स, जिसे इलेक्ट्रोलिसिस या ई 10 एस के रूप में भी जाना जाता है, फ़ायरफ़ॉक्स स्थिर उपयोगकर्ताओं के सबसेट के लिए सक्षम होने वाला है।

निम्नलिखित गाइड आपको फ़ायरफ़ॉक्स की बहु-प्रक्रिया वास्तुकला के बारे में जानकारी प्रदान करता है। यह बताता है कि सुविधा इसके लिए क्या प्राथमिकताएं और प्राथमिकताएं प्रदान करती है, ऐड-ऑन संगतता को कवर करती है, और सुविधा के भविष्य पर एक नज़र डालती है।

मोज़िला फ़ायरफ़ॉक्स स्थिर उपयोगकर्ता के लिए एक बहु-प्रक्रिया आर्किटेक्चर को सक्षम करने की योजना बनाता है जब ब्राउज़र संस्करण 48 तक पहुंचता है। यदि चीजें नियोजित हैं, तो फ़ायरफ़ॉक्स 48 2 अगस्त 2016 को जारी किया जाएगा

बहु-प्रक्रिया रोलआउट शुरू हो गया है, और चल रहा है (फ़ायरफ़ॉक्स 52 के रूप में)। मोज़िला फ़ायरफ़ॉक्स 54 में स्थिर आबादी के लिए सामग्री प्रक्रियाओं की संख्या को चार तक बढ़ाने की योजना बना रहा है।

मल्टी-प्रोसेस फ़ायरफ़ॉक्स

इलेक्ट्रोलिसिस कार्यक्षमता पृष्ठभूमि बाल प्रक्रियाओं में वेब से संबंधित सामग्री को होस्ट, प्रस्तुत या निष्पादित करती है, जो विभिन्न ipdl प्रोटोकॉल के माध्यम से 'माता-पिता' फ़ायरफ़ॉक्स ब्राउज़र के साथ संचार करती है।

मल्टी-प्रोसेस आर्किटेक्चर, कार्यों में प्रक्रियाओं को अलग करके ब्राउज़र की स्थिरता, प्रदर्शन और सुरक्षा में सुधार करता है।

बहु-प्रक्रिया फ़ायरफ़ॉक्स का पहला पुनरावृत्ति NPAPI प्लगइन्स, मीडिया प्लेबैक और वेब सामग्री को बाल प्रक्रियाओं में ले जाता है और इस प्रकार उन्हें ब्राउज़र के कोर से अलग करता है।

पता लगाएँ कि क्या मल्टी-प्रोसेस समर्थन सक्षम है

multi-process firefox

बहु-प्रक्रिया फ़ायरफ़ॉक्स सक्षम है या नहीं यह जानने का सबसे आसान तरीका निम्नलिखित है:

  1. लोड के बारे में: फ़ायरफ़ॉक्स एड्रेस बार में समर्थन।
  2. शीर्ष के पास एप्लिकेशन मूल बातें के तहत 'मल्टीप्रोसेस विंडोज' का पता लगाएँ।

यह सक्षम या अक्षम पढ़ा जाना चाहिए, और आपको ब्राउज़र में मल्टी-प्रोसेस कार्यक्षमता की स्थिति के बारे में सीधा जवाब देता है।

फ़ायरफ़ॉक्स में इलेक्ट्रोलिसिस को सक्षम करना

यदि फ़ायरफ़ॉक्स में बहु-प्रक्रिया समर्थन अभी तक सक्षम नहीं है, तो आप इसे मैन्युअल रूप से सक्षम कर सकते हैं। यह सच है भले ही आप फ़ायरफ़ॉक्स 47 को चलाते हैं क्योंकि कार्यक्षमता पहले से ही है।

ऐसा करने से पहले, आप ऐड-ऑन के लिए संगतता जांच चलाना चाहते हैं। यदि आप ऐड-ऑन नहीं चलाते हैं, फ़ायरफ़ॉक्स उपयोगकर्ताओं के बारे में 40% नहीं है मोज़िला के अनुसार, आप कदम को छोड़ सकते हैं।

ऐड-ऑन संगतता को सत्यापित करना

firefox e10s compatibility

हालांकि आप पहले संगतता को सत्यापित किए बिना इलेक्ट्रोलीज़ को सक्षम करके तुरंत पानी में कूद सकते हैं, यह सत्यापित करने के लिए अत्यधिक सुझाव दिया जाता है कि ऐसा करने से पहले सभी महत्वपूर्ण ऐड-ऑन ई 10 के साथ संगत हैं।

तुम बाहर की जाँच कर सकते हैं क्या हम अभी तक e10S हैं साइट जो शीर्ष ऐड-ऑन और उनकी संगतता को ई 10 के साथ सूचीबद्ध करती है। फ़ायरफ़ॉक्स ऐड-ऑन के बहुमत का परीक्षण नहीं किया जाता है, ताकि साइट पर आपके ऐड-ऑन की जांच के बाद आप कोई भी समझदार न हों।

आप क्या कर सकते है, फ़ायरफ़ॉक्स में एक द्वितीयक प्रोफ़ाइल बनाता है , पहले प्रोफ़ाइल के सभी एक्सटेंशन को कॉपी करें, और उस माध्यमिक प्रोफ़ाइल के लिए e10s सक्षम करें।

यह हालांकि आदर्श से बहुत दूर है। एक विकल्प सभी ऐड-ऑन को अक्षम करना है, ई 10 को सक्षम करना है, और एक-एक करके एक्सटेंशन को यह पता लगाने में सक्षम करना है कि क्या वे संगत हैं।

फ़ायरफ़ॉक्स में इलेक्ट्रोलिसिस को सक्षम / अक्षम करें

browser.tabs.remote.autostart

बहु-प्रक्रिया फ़ायरफ़ॉक्स को सक्षम या अक्षम करने के लिए, निम्न कार्य करें

  1. इसके बारे में टाइप करें: ब्राउज़र के एड्रेस बार में कॉन्फ़िगर करें।
  2. पुष्टि करें कि आप सावधान रहेंगे।
  3. निम्न को खोजें browser.tabs.remote.autostart
  4. वरीयता पर डबल-क्लिक करें।

Browser.tabs.remote.autostart का मान सेट करना फ़ायरफ़ॉक्स में मल्टी-प्रोसेस आर्किटेक्चर को सक्षम बनाता है, इसे झूठी अक्षम करने के लिए सेट करता है।

ध्यान दें : फ़ायरफ़ॉक्स 68 के बाद से, फाल्स को वरीयता देने का कोई प्रभाव नहीं है। फ़ायरफ़ॉक्स उपयोगकर्ता वरीयता की परवाह किए बिना स्वचालित रूप से सही पर वरीयता निर्धारित करता है।

कृपया ध्यान दें कि वरीयता के मूल्य को बदलने पर आपको ब्राउज़र को पुनरारंभ करना होगा।

कुछ कॉन्फ़िगरेशन, यदि पहुंच का उपयोग किया जाता है या ऐड-ऑन असंगत हैं, इलेक्ट्रोलिसिस को सक्षम होने से रोकते हैं।

disabled by addons

disabled accessibility tools

के बारे में: समर्थन पृष्ठ का उल्लेख पहले कारण को सूचीबद्ध करता है ताकि आप जान सकें कि बहु-प्रक्रिया क्यों काम नहीं कर रही है।

आप फ़ायरफ़ॉक्स में बहु-प्रक्रिया कार्यक्षमता को सक्षम कर सकते हैं। मेरा सुझाव है कि आप अपने उपयोगकर्ता प्रोफ़ाइल का बैकअप इससे पहले कि आप करते हैं।

  1. इसके बारे में टाइप करें: ब्राउज़र के एड्रेस बार में कॉन्फ़िगर करें और एंटर करें।
  2. राइट-क्लिक करें और नया> बूलियन चुनें।
  3. नाम दें browser.tabs.remote.force: सक्षम
  4. इसके मान को सेट करें सच

फ़ायरफ़ॉक्स 68 में शुरू, प्राथमिकता अब उपलब्ध नहीं है।

ध्यान दें कि यदि ऐड-ऑन e10s के साथ असंगत हैं, तो संगतता को मजबूर करने का प्रदर्शन पर बड़ा प्रभाव पड़ सकता है।

एक और प्राथमिकता है कि आपको इसके बारे में बदलने की आवश्यकता हो सकती है: कॉन्फ़िगरेशन।

  1. Extension.e10sMultiBlockedByAddons के लिए खोजें
  2. असत्य को प्राथमिकता दें।

यह ऐड-ऑन द्वारा कई सामग्री प्रक्रियाओं को अवरुद्ध होने से रोकता है।

सामग्री प्रक्रियाओं की संख्या बदलना

firefox multi-process content processes

बहु-प्रक्रिया फ़ायरफ़ॉक्स सक्षम होने पर अभी मोज़िला फ़ायरफ़ॉक्स डिफ़ॉल्ट रूप से एक सामग्री प्रक्रिया का उपयोग करता है। मोज़िला ने उस संस्करण में सामग्री प्रक्रियाओं की संख्या को बढ़ाकर फ़ायरफ़ॉक्स 54 में बदलने की योजना बनाई है।

आप अभी गिनती को संशोधित कर सकते हैं , सीमा बढ़ाने या घटाने के लिए। ध्यान दें कि फ़ायरफ़ॉक्स ब्राउज़र की सेटिंग में एक विकल्प के साथ जहाज करेगा जो अंततः आपको ऐसा करने देता है।

  • इसके बारे में टाइप करें: ब्राउज़र के एड्रेस बार में कॉन्फ़िगर करें और एंटर करें।
  • Dom.ipc.processCount के लिए खोजें।
  • मूल्य पर डबल-क्लिक करें, और इसे बदलें। आपके द्वारा दर्ज किया गया नंबर फ़ायरफ़ॉक्स का उपयोग करने वाली सामग्री प्रक्रियाओं की संख्या है।

जब मल्टीप्रोसेस विंडोज सक्षम होती है

multiple firefox processes

बहु-प्रक्रिया सक्षम है या नहीं, यह जानने के लिए आप फ़ायरफ़ॉक्स में सपोर्ट पेज की जाँच कर सकते हैं।

जब आप एक प्रक्रिया प्रबंधक चलाते हैं, तो आप कई फ़ायरफ़ॉक्स। Exe सूचनाएँ देखेंगे, उदा। विंडोज टास्क मैनेजर जिसमें इलेक्ट्रोलिसिस सक्षम है पर प्रकाश डाला गया है।

फ़ायरफ़ॉक्स को पहले की तरह ही अधिकांश भाग के लिए होना चाहिए। आदर्श रूप से, बहु-प्रक्रिया कार्यक्षमता को सक्षम करने से ब्राउज़र के प्रदर्शन और स्थिरता में तुरंत सुधार होना चाहिए।

हालाँकि आप सामान्य रैम उपयोग की तुलना में अधिक देख सकते हैं। मोज़िला ने पुष्टि की कि इलेक्ट्रोलिसिस के साथ फ़ायरफ़ॉक्स लगभग 20% अधिक रैम का उपयोग करेगा ।

आप यह देख सकते हैं कि फ़ायरफ़ॉक्स अपनी मल्टी-प्रोसेस कार्यक्षमता के लिए कितनी प्रक्रियाओं का उपयोग करता है ।

भविष्य

मोज़िला फ़ीचर के शुरुआती रोल के बाद मल्टी-प्रोसेस फ़ायरफ़ॉक्स पर काम करना जारी रखेगा। संगठन की योजना सैंडबॉक्सिंग को फ़ायरफ़ॉक्स पर लाने की है, जो विंडोज़ पर, क्रोमियम सैंडबॉक्स पर आधारित है जिसे Google क्रोम में उपयोग करता है। सक्षम होने पर यह सैंडबॉक्स सुरक्षा में काफी सुधार करेगा।

अब तुम: फ़ायरफ़ॉक्स में ई 10 के आने वाले रोल पर आपका क्या ख्याल है?